METHOD OF DETERMINATION OF RELATIVE DAMPING COEFFICIENTS OF MECHANICAL AND ELECTROMECHANICAL OSCILLATORY SYSTEMS BY ACCELERATION

机译:通过加速确定机械和机电振动系统的相对阻尼系数的方法

摘要

FIELD: measurement technology; exploration of complex dynamic systems. SUBSTANCE: acceleration of motion is measured as kinematic parameter of oscillations; specific frequencies corresponding to minimum actual and maximum imaginary components of amplitude phase-frequency characteristics by acceleration of motion are netted; relative damping coefficient is calculated by formula. EFFECT: enhanced efficiency. 1 dwg
